dpdk-vdev='eth_bond0,mode=2,slave=0000:81:00.1,slave=0000:82:00.1,xmit_policy=l34' 上面的命令最后做的操作其实就是把“eth_bond0,mode=2,slave=0000:81:00.1,slave=0000:82:00.1,xmit_policy=l34”传给了dpdk库 “dpdk-vdev”是我自己添加的参数, “eth_bond0,mode=2,slave=0000:81:00.1,sla...
ovs-vsctl add-br br-dpdk -- set bridge br-dpdk datapath_type=netdev ovs-vsctl add-bond br-dpdk dpdk-bond p0 p1 -- set Interface p0 type=dpdk options:dpdk-devargs=0000:05:00.0 -- set Interface p1 type=dpdk options:dpdk-devargs=0000:06:00.0 ovs-vsctl set port dpdk-bond...
ovs-vsctl del-port br0 ens33 2.DPDK接口和DPDK bonds以后学习DPDK再进行补充 (三)不同网桥通过patch port连接 ovs里的不同bridge之间可以通过patch port进行连接,类似于linux的veth接口。 通过patch port 连接bridge时,这两个bridge的datapath_type最好相同,不然可能会导致数据不通的情况。 OVS通过在不同的bridge...
ovs-vsctl del-port br0 eth1 # for DPDK ovs-vsctl add-port br0 dpdk1 -- set interface dpdk1 type=dpdk options:dpdk-devargs=0000:01:00.0 # for DPDK bonds ovs-vsctl add-bond br0 dpdkbond0 dpdk1 dpdk2 \ -- set interface dpdk1 type=dpdk options:dpdk-devargs=0000:01:00.0 \ -- ...
dpdkbond0 mtu: 9000 rx_queue: 2 members: - type: ovs_dpdk_port name: dpdk0 members: - type: interface name: nic3 - type: ovs_dpdk_port name: dpdk1 members: - type: interface name: nic4注意 要包含多个 dpdk 设备,请为...
为LACP 配置 OVS DPDK 绑定 8.3.1. 准备 Open vSwitch 8.3.2. 配置 LACP Bond 8.3.3. 从 OVS 启用/禁用端口 9. 使用 OVS DPDK 部署不同的绑定模式 使用OVS DPDK 部署不同的绑定模式 9.1. 解决方案 10. 在 ovs-vsctl 显示消息中接收 Could not open network device dpdk0(不...
OVS_DPDK OVS_XDP OVS基本命令 附录 OpenFlow协议 Vxlan协议 编译安装 参考 OVS概览 1.经典架构 OVS可以划分为三大块:管理面、数据面和控制面 数据面就是以用户态的ovs-vswitchd和内核态的datapath为主的转发模块,以及与之相关联的数据库模块ovsdb-server, 控制面主要是由ovs-ofctl模块负责,基于OpenFlow协议与数据...
在dpdk节点上,我们使用的是user space模式,此时是可以不用安装openvswitch.ko这个内核模块。因此,我们在ovs的服务启动脚本中也不会去判断这个内核模块有没有加载, 当然更不会去自动加载该服务。 所以如果碰到这个问题,一般表明你装错版本了:( 再来说说dpdk的那些坑事儿 ...
1、ovs支持bond现状ovs 支持自身bond接口,命令操作如下: ovs-vsctl add-bond br0 dpdkbond dpdk0 dpdk1 -- set Interface dpdk0 type=dpdk -- set Interface dpdk1 type=dpdk以下说法引用于:的bond部分 物理网卡需要和原网络结构兼容,需 ovs架构 定时丢包 服务器 网络设备 传参数 转载 jojo 2024-02-29 ...
$ ovs-appctl bond/show dpdkbond0 bond_mode: active-backup bond may use recirculation: no, Recirc-ID : -1 bond-hash-basis: 0 updelay: 0 ms downdelay: 0 ms lacp_status: off lacp_fallback_ab: false active slave mac: a0:36:9f:e5:da...